HBKU Hosts Discussion on Legal Issues in Motorsport in Advance of the 2nd Qatar Grand Prix
The College of Law at Hamad Bin Khalifa University (HBKU) and the Qatar Motor and Motorcycle Federation (QMMF) co-hosted a panel discussion highlighting the legal issues in motorsport. The session was held in advance of the second Qatar Grand Prix, which is scheduled for 6 to 8 October.
Titled ‘Legal Issues in Motorsport: Preparing for the Qatar Grand Prix’, the panel featured renowned local and international experts led by QMMF Executive Director Amro Al-Hamad.
Al-Hamad gave the introductory remarks, underlining the importance of Qatar’s hosting of a prominent motorsport event. His comments set the stage for a lively discussion about governance, dispute resolution and intellectual property – all relevant subjects since motorsport, particularly at the Grand Prix level, is highly rules-based.
Muhammed Bhaimohmed, a Senior Counsel at the FIFA World Cup Qatar 2022™ presented the lessons learned from the FIFA World Cup™, which the panel discussed extensively in connection with the upcoming Qatar Grand Prix. A second key feature of the discussion was the examination of the complex regulatory and dispute resolution processes in motorsport, which law professor, Zachary Calo detailed with lawyer Mark Buckley, a partner at Fladgate, and who has been involved in numerous cases.
HBKU College of Law Dean Susan L Karamanian noted that the second Qatar Grand Prix reflects the exponential growth experienced by the MENA region’s motorsports sector. She said that it will require locally-based legal professionals, well-versed in the law in the field, to continue its development, which falls under their mission – to build regional capacity with global relevance.
